An interesting Dutch Lignum vitae wool bowl in heart and sap wood, having ring turned decoration. Note the difference to English wool bowls, that are slightly deeper and plain with no decoration. They were made of lignum vitae for their weight, which kept them in a stable position. They were used for placing a ball of wool, and with a smooth interior allowing the wool to unwind when in use without becoming tangled. The whole has an excellent colour, condition and patination.
Dutch Circa 1840
